关于javascript:cookie-localStorage-sessionStorage的区别没废话版本

40次阅读

共计 374 个字符,预计需要花费 1 分钟才能阅读完成。

cookie 数据存储内容很小,只在过期工夫内无效,即便浏览器敞开
cookie 的用法很简略,js 也能够通过 documnet.cookie=” 名称 = 值;”
cookie 个别用做为登陆态保留、明码、个人信息等要害信息保留应用,所以为了平安也是恪守同源策略准则的。

localStorage 用于长久化的本地存储,除非被动删除数据,否则数据是永远不会过期的
能够用于存储该浏览器对该页面的拜访次数,当然,如果换个浏览器,这个次数就从新开始计数了
还能够用来存储一些固定不变的页面信息,这样就不须要每次都从新加载了,这个值也能够进行笼罩

sessionStorage 用于本地存储一个会话中的数据,不是一种长久化的本地存储,仅仅是会话级别的存储
也就是说只有这个浏览器窗口没有敞开, 即便刷新页面或进入同源另一页面,数据依然存在
敞开窗口后,sessionStorage 即被销毁

正文完
 0